注冊(cè) |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)計(jì)算機(jī)組織與體系結(jié)構(gòu)谷歌眼鏡開發(fā)入門經(jīng)典

谷歌眼鏡開發(fā)入門經(jīng)典

谷歌眼鏡開發(fā)入門經(jīng)典

定 價(jià):¥59.00

作 者: (美)Jeff Tang
出版社: 清華大學(xué)出版社
叢編項(xiàng): 移動(dòng)開發(fā)經(jīng)典叢書
標(biāo) 簽: 暫缺

ISBN: 9787302401452 出版時(shí)間: 2015-06-01 包裝:
開本: 16開 頁數(shù): 336 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  Google Glass將是目前以及未來幾年風(fēng)靡全球的革命性的移動(dòng)計(jì)算平臺(tái),《谷歌眼鏡開發(fā)入門經(jīng)典》是學(xué)習(xí)如何為Google Glass開發(fā)應(yīng)用的首選。移動(dòng)開發(fā)者們一直在思考未來,現(xiàn)在就從Google Glass開始吧!《谷歌眼鏡開發(fā)入門經(jīng)典 移動(dòng)開發(fā)經(jīng)典叢書》包含許多令人激動(dòng)的項(xiàng)目,極富實(shí)踐性。通過每一個(gè)使用GDK(Glass Development Kit)的Glass開發(fā)主題,你將學(xué)習(xí)谷歌眼鏡的基礎(chǔ)知識(shí)以及如何配置開發(fā)環(huán)境:● Glass用戶界面● 攝像頭和圖像處理● 視頻:基礎(chǔ)與應(yīng)用● 語音和音頻● 網(wǎng)絡(luò)、藍(lán)牙和社交● 位置、地圖和傳感器● 圖形、動(dòng)畫和游戲你還將學(xué)習(xí)如何使用Mirror API開發(fā)基于Web的Glassware并用它來啟動(dòng)GDK應(yīng)用。每個(gè)主題都包含豐富的示例,以說明Glass真正能做些什么,并幫助你快速開始自己的應(yīng)用開發(fā)。《谷歌眼鏡開發(fā)入門經(jīng)典 移動(dòng)開發(fā)經(jīng)典叢書》作者Jeff Tang成功開發(fā)過基于各種平臺(tái)的移動(dòng)應(yīng)用、Web應(yīng)用和企業(yè)級(jí)應(yīng)用,并且在用戶體驗(yàn)上有較高造詣。他通過炫酷而實(shí)用的示例,將豐富的知識(shí)帶到了本書中,并同時(shí)激發(fā)和引導(dǎo)出你的創(chuàng)造力。《谷歌眼鏡開發(fā)入門經(jīng)典 移動(dòng)開發(fā)經(jīng)典叢書》針對(duì)所有希望開始為Glass開發(fā)GDK和Mirror API應(yīng)用的開發(fā)者。無論是Android、iOS開發(fā)人員,還是Web應(yīng)用或企業(yè)級(jí)應(yīng)用開發(fā)人員,你都不會(huì)想錯(cuò)過Glass帶來的機(jī)遇。那么現(xiàn)在就從《谷歌眼鏡開發(fā)入門經(jīng)典》入手,從中獲得靈感吧!

作者簡(jiǎn)介

  Jeff Tang已成功在多個(gè)平臺(tái)上開發(fā)過移動(dòng)、Web和企業(yè)級(jí)應(yīng)用,他在20世紀(jì)就已獲得Microsoft Certified Developer(微軟認(rèn)證開發(fā)工程師)和Sun Certified Java Developer (Sun認(rèn)證Java開發(fā)工程師),并在App Store中發(fā)布了多款暢銷的iOS應(yīng)用,是Google認(rèn)可的Top Android Market Developer (頂級(jí)Android Market開發(fā)者)。Jeff擁有計(jì)算機(jī)科學(xué)人工智能方向的碩士學(xué)位,并且崇尚終生學(xué)習(xí)。他熱愛籃球運(yùn)動(dòng)(他有一次投中11個(gè)三分球并連續(xù)28次罰球命中),喜歡閱讀Ernest Hemingway (歐內(nèi)斯特?海明威)和Mario Puzo (馬里奧?普佐)的作品,并且夢(mèng)想著環(huán)游世界。

圖書目錄

第1章  入門指南 1 1.1  為什么選擇Glass? 1 1.2  什么是Glass和Glassware? 2 1.3  Glass可以做什么 4 1.4  可以開發(fā)什么樣的Glassware? 5 1.4.1  基于Mirror API的Glassware 5 1.4.2  GDK Glassware 7 1.4.3  什么時(shí)候用哪一個(gè) 7 1.5  Google的Glassware政策 8 1.6  為什么選用本書? 8 1.7  本書讀者對(duì)象 9 1.7.1  對(duì)于初級(jí)Android開發(fā)者 9 1.7.2  對(duì)于中級(jí)和高級(jí)Android開發(fā)者 9 1.7.3  對(duì)于iOS開發(fā)者 10 1.7.4  對(duì)于Web開發(fā)者 10 1.7.5  對(duì)于其他程序員 10 1.7.6  對(duì)于非程序員 10 1.8  資源 10 1.9  問題和反饋 11 1.10  本章小結(jié) 11 第2章  你的第一個(gè) GDK應(yīng)用 13 2.1  搭建開發(fā)環(huán)境 13 2.1.1  系統(tǒng)要求 13 2.1.2  Android Developer Tools 13 2.2  使用Glass 17 2.2.1  在Glass上開啟調(diào)試模式 17 2.2.2  adb命令 17 2.2.3  在Windows上安裝和運(yùn)行USB驅(qū)動(dòng) 18 2.2.4  在更大的屏幕上顯示Glass屏幕 20 2.2.5  用模擬設(shè)備或模擬器進(jìn)行開發(fā) 21 2.2.6  測(cè)試GDK示例 22 2.3  HelloGlass Glassware 24 2.4  進(jìn)一步探討細(xì)節(jié) 29 2.4.1  總體畫面 29 2.4.2  源代碼 30 2.4.3  資源文件 36 2.4.4  AndroidManifest.xml 38 2.5  本章小結(jié) 39 第3章  Glass用戶界面 41 3.1  概覽 41 3.2  Glass風(fēng)格的卡片 44 3.3  動(dòng)態(tài)卡片 45 3.3.1  低頻動(dòng)態(tài)卡片 45 3.3.2  高頻動(dòng)態(tài)卡片 48 3.3.3  菜單 55 3.4  沉浸模式 56 3.4.1  2D畫布繪圖 56 3.4.2  手勢(shì)和監(jiān)聽器 61 3.4.3  菜單和頭部動(dòng)作 62 3.4.4  3D OpenGL ES繪圖 63 3.5  用戶界面的選擇 68 3.6  主題和UI Widget 69 3.7  本章小結(jié) 71 第4章  攝像頭與圖像處理 73 4.1  拍照 73 4.1.1  簡(jiǎn)單方式 74 4.1.2  自定義方法 74 4.2  照片瀏覽 87 4.3  條形碼識(shí)別 89 4.4  OCR 92 4.5  圖像Web搜索 96 4.6  OpenCV 98 4.7  完整的應(yīng)用 102 4.8  本章小結(jié) 102 第5章  視頻:基礎(chǔ)和應(yīng)用 103 5.1  拍攝視頻 103 5.1.1  快速方式 104 5.1.2  自定義方式 106 5.2  播放視頻 112 5.3  OpenCV視頻處理 116 5.4  FFmpeg視頻處理 121 5.4.1  在Glass上測(cè)試庫客戶端 121 5.4.2  集成FFmpeg庫 122 5.5  YouTube集成 127 5.5.1  調(diào)用數(shù)據(jù)API 127 5.5.2  顯示查詢結(jié)果 128 5.5.3  進(jìn)行語音查詢 132 5.5.4  播放視頻并且唱卡拉OK 133 5.5.5  持續(xù)更新代碼 134 5.5.6  運(yùn)行應(yīng)用 135 5.6  本章小結(jié) 135 第6章  語音與音頻 137 6.1  語音輸入 137 6.2  音頻錄制與播放 144 6.2.1  使用MediaRecorder和 MediaPlayer 144 6.2.2  使用AudioRecord與 AudioTrack 147 6.2.3  改進(jìn)卡拉OK應(yīng)用 153 6.3  音調(diào)探測(cè) 154 6.4  按鍵音探測(cè) 157 6.5  歌曲識(shí)別 159 6.6  本章小結(jié) 160 第7章  網(wǎng)絡(luò)、Bluetooth與社交 163 7.1  HTTP請(qǐng)求 164 7.1.1  HTTP GET 165 7.1.2  HTTP POST 166 7.1.3  HTTP文件上傳 167 7.2  Socket編程 170 7.2.1  Glass客戶端與Android服務(wù)器 170 7.2.2  Glass服務(wù)器與Android客戶端 177 7.2.3  Glass客戶端與 iOS服務(wù)器 177 7.2.4  Glass服務(wù)器與iOS客戶端 179 7.3  Bluetooth 181 7.3.1  Classic Bluetooth 182 7.3.2  Bluetooth Low Energy 191 7.3.3  其他建議 197 7.4  社交化 198 7.5  本章小結(jié) 201 第8章  位置、地圖與傳感器 203 8.1  位置 203 8.1.1  獲取位置 204 8.1.2  顯示地址 207 8.1.3  顯示與縮放地圖 208 8.1.4  尋找附近的地點(diǎn) 211 8.1.5  搜索分享的圖片 218 8.2  傳感器 218 8.2.1  支持的傳感器 218 8.2.2  收集傳感器數(shù)據(jù) 219 8.2.3  搖一搖 230 8.2.4  檢測(cè)金屬 231 8.2.5  開發(fā)指南針 232 8.2.6  尋找行星 234 8.3  本章小結(jié) 234 第9章  圖形、動(dòng)畫與游戲 235 9.1  圖形 235 9.1.1  Canvas繪圖 236 9.1.2  繪制形狀 238 9.1.3  徒手繪畫 239 9.1.4  位圖操作 242 9.1.5  OpenGL ES繪圖 244 9.2  動(dòng)畫 247 9.2.1  使用XML與編程方式動(dòng)態(tài)化屬性 247 9.2.2  使用XML與編程方式組合動(dòng)畫 250 9.2.3  使用動(dòng)畫監(jiān)聽器 251 9.3  Glass上的游戲引擎 254 9.3.1  Cocos2d-x 3.0 254 9.3.2  libgdx 265 9.3.3  AndEngine 271 9.4  開發(fā)基于傳感器的游戲 276 9.5  本章小結(jié) 279 第10章  Mirror API 281 10.1  配置環(huán)境 281 10.1.1  使用PHP 282 10.1.2  使用Java 285 10.2  Mirror API 290 10.2.1  概述 291 10.2.2  時(shí)間軸與靜態(tài)卡片 292 10.2.3  聯(lián)系人 305 10.2.4  訂閱 308 10.2.5  位置 308 10.3  圖像處理:Mirror API方式 309 10.4  創(chuàng)建并測(cè)試Java版本的新Mirror應(yīng)用 312 10.5  NBA Roster應(yīng)用 312 10.6  企業(yè)級(jí)應(yīng)用 317 10.7  設(shè)計(jì)原則 317 10.8  本章小結(jié) 318 10.9  在繼續(xù)之前 318

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) www.talentonion.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)